In this afternoon workshop, we
will explore the elegantly-refined 5,000 year old Yogic tradition of working
with the KOSHA'S (sheaths or veils to the Authentic Self). The KOSHA'S
are an aspect of Yogic philosophy which address - and attempt to bring us in
greater contact with - our physical, energetic, emotional, mental, intuitive
and casual bodies. It's a psycho-spiritual model for living a
balanced, mature, healthy, authentic life.
